Step‑by‑Step Instructions for The BEST Chocolate Chip Cookies
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in your delightful cookie journey by preheating your oven to 400°F (or 385°F for those with hotter ovens). This essential step ensures your cookies bake evenly, achieving that perfect texture. While the oven warms up, you can focus on preparing your cookie dough, as a hot oven is critical for that chewy and crispy texture in your chocolate chip cookies.
Step 2: Cream the Butter and Sugars
In a large mixing bowl, combine the cold but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ar. Using an electric mixer, cream these together on medium speed for about 4 minutes until the mixture is light and fluffy. This process helps incorporate air, which is key for the right texture in your chocolate chip cookies, creating a rich base that will elevate their taste.
Step 3: Add the Eggs and Vanilla
Next, crack in the eggs and pour in the vanilla extract. Mix the ingredients together for another minute until fully incorporated. The eggs will bind everything together while the vanilla enhances the flavor profile, giving your chocolate chip cookies that delightful aroma that fills the kitchen with happiness!
Step 4: Combine Dry Ingredients
In a separate bowl, whisk together your all-purpose flour, cornstarch, baking soda, and salt. This step is crucial as it evenly distributes the leavening agents and ensures a well-balanced dough.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ing only until just combined. This care helps prevent tough cookies, keeping your chocolate chip cookies soft and inviting.
Step 5: Fold in the Chocolate Chips
Gently fold in your chocolate chips, ensuring they’re evenly distributed throughout the dough. This is where the magic happens, turning simple dough into a decadent treat! Make sure not to overmix at this stage to maintain the delicious texture of your chocolate chip cookies. The anticipation of those gooey chocolate bits is absolutely worth it.
Step 6: Chill the Dough (Optional)
If time allows, wrap your dough in plastic wrap and chill it in the refrigerator for 24 hours. This step enhances the flavors meld together beautifully and results in a richer cookie. However, if you’re short on time, you can skip this step and scoop the dough right onto your baking sheets for immediate baking.
Step 7: Bake the Cookies
Scoop generous portions of cookie dough onto a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Place them in your preheated oven and bake for 8 to 11 minutes. Look for golden edges and slightly undercooked centers to ensure a perfect chewy texture. Keep a close eye on them—ovens can vary, and you want that delightful balance in your chocolate chip cookies!
Step 8: Cool and Enjoy
Once baked, remove the cookies from the oven and allow them to sit on the baking sheet for 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ely. This brief rest helps the centers firm up while keeping those edges crispy. Now, savor the moment as you enjoy your warm, scrumptious chocolate chip cookies!

Make Ahead Options
These Chocolate Chip Cookies are perfect for meal prep enthusiasts! You can prepare the dough up to 24 hours in advance, allowing the flavors to develop beautifully. Simply mix the ingredients as directed, then wrap the dough in plastic wrap and refrigerate it. This chilling step not only enhances the flavor but also ensures the cookies maintain their chewy texture. If you want to go one step further, scoop the dough into individual balls and freeze them, which allows for baking fresh cookies anytime within 3 months. When ready to bake, simply preheat the oven and bake straight from frozen, adding an extra minute or two to the baking time for deliciously warm, freshly baked Chocolate Chip Cookies with minimal effort!
Expert Tips for Chocolate Chip Cookies
- Cold Butter Matters: Use cold butter for chewier cookies; warm or softened butter can create thinner cookies that lack structure.
- Mix Gently: Combine ingredients just until incorporated to avoid tough cookies; overmixing can ruin that perfect texture.
- Chill for Flavor: If you have time, chill the dough for 24 hours; this enhances flavor and results in a more decadent cookie.
- Watch the Bake Time: Keep an eye on your cookies while baking; they firm up even after coming out of the oven, so slightly underbake for the best texture.
- Experiment with Mix-Ins: Feel free to explore various types of chocolate chips or add nuts and dried fruits; these variations can elevate classic chocolate chip cookies to a whole new level!
- Store Smartly: Store cooled cookies in an airtight container to maintain freshness, or freeze the dough for later baking.

Can I freeze chocolate chip cookie dough?
Yes! To freeze your cookie dough, scoop it into balls and place them on a baking sheet. Flash freeze them for about 1 hour, then transfer the dough balls to a freezer-safe bag or container. They can be stored for up to 3 months. When ready to bake, just adjust the baking time by a couple of minutes since they go straight into the oven from frozen.
What can I do if my cookies turn out flat?
If your chocolate chip cookies are flat, it might be due to softened butter or not enough flour. Always use cold butter, and ensure you measure your flour accurately—spoon it into the measuring cup and level it off with a knife. If you notice your dough is too soft, chilling it in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es can help achieve that desired thickness!
